VNET Group Inc vs Exxon Mobil Corporation — how do they compare? VNET Group Inc trades at $6.57 (market cap $1.92B), while Exxon Mobil Corporation trades at $164.41 (market cap $660.62B). The key difference: Exxon Mobil Corporation is far larger — about 344.1× VNET Group Inc's market cap, and Exxon Mobil Corporation pays a 2.56% dividend while VNET Group Inc pays none. About VNET Group Inc

VNET Group, formerly 21Vianet, is a leading carrier-neutral data center services provider in China. It operates a dual-core strategy: a large-scale retail business serving over 7,000 enterprise customers and an aggressive wholesale segment (Hyperscale 2.0) designed to meet the high-density power and cooling demands of large-scale AI and cloud platforms.

About Exxon Mobil Corporation

Exxon Mobil Corporation operates petroleum and petro chemicals businesses. The Company provides operations include exploration and production of oil and gas, electric power generation, and coal and minerals operations. Exxon Mobil also manufactures and markets fuels, lubricants, and chemicals. Exxon Mobil serves customers worldwide.
